This is made with rubber stamp ink and fingerprints but we'll make similar ornaments with paper and a heart punch. Or we'll just color circles. Haven't decided yet.
***
***
This is made with a styrofoam ball (cut in half + brown paint) and cardstock. Markers are pushed in about an inch (2.5 cm) deep.
***
***
A thankful tree. Everyone writes on the cardstock leaves what they are thankful for.
